Homebound instruction is an educational support program designed for students who are unable to attend school due to a medical reasons. The program may be of short or long term duration. Requests for homebound instruction must be substantiated by a health care provider.
The school team will design a homebound plan for each student based on student need and ability to tolerate instruction. Homebound plans are typically created to support priority academic areas and not all academic areas lend themselves well to this type of instruction.
Homebound instruction is not tutoring nor does it replace a student's typical school schedule.
Staff will utilize technology to share information and communicate with parent(s) and student.
